Introduction to RF
This module introduces some of the basic equations of electromagnetism, and classifies the various electromagnetic waves according to their wavelength/frequency. Radio Frequency, or “RF”, is put into its context in this spectrum of electromagnetic waves. The final part of this module, “Plasma Basics” is also available as a stand-alone download, and briefly explains what a plasma is, and how RF is used to ignite and sustain useful plasmas.

RF Generators
This module introduces the basic construction of an RF power supply, and the principles of RF electronics and design. After a discussion of the main sub-systems in an RF generator, some common problems with RF generators are raised.

RF Matching
The sometimes confusing world of Impedance Matching is hopefully explained in this module, building up from the idea of a mis-match creating a standing wave, and the fundamentals of complex impedances. The Principles of matching are then introduced, and the beauty of the Smith Chart explained before a practical example of impedance matching is worked through. Finally the sub-systems necessary for an automated matching unit are outlined.

Introduction to RF Power Measurement
This module introduces the concepts involved in measuring RF power with a wattmeter, or similar RF sensor, and goes on to discuss the various uses of a directional coupler, for example for measuring waveforms with an oscilloscope, or looking at the frequency distribution with a spectrum analyzer. There is also an explanation of Vpp and Vdc measurement, before taking a look at coaxial cable principles, and practical selection tips for RF applications.
